Parallel DD performance:
* Copy the local-script.sh in ${mountpoint}/benchmark/ directory
* Edit it so the blocksize and count are as per the requirements
* Edit the launch-script.sh script to make sure paths, mountpoints etc are
alright.
* run 'lauch-script.sh'
* after the run, you can get the aggregated result by adding all the 3rd entry
in output.$(hostname) entries in 'output/' directory.

rdd: random dd - tool to do a sequence of random block-sized continuous
read writes starting at a random offset
gcc -pthread rdd.c -o rdd
